The former Pyramids FC owner Turki Al-Sheikh has hailed his relationship with Al Ahly president Mahmoud El-Khatib after visiting him in Cairo.

Al-Sheikh posted some photos of him alongside El-Khatib on his official Facebook page, captioning, " During my visit to my older brother captain Mahmoud El-Khatib. I had the honor to meet your family and ate the best food in the world."

Earlier today, the Ex-honorary President of Al-Ahly club stirred Controversy by sharing a photo of him alongside the retired footballer legend José Hernández (Guti).

Al-Sheikh posted this photo on his official Facebook page, captioning, ” With Real Madrid and Spain’s national team’s Legend Guti in Cairo and a surprise.”

On August 2,  the Saudi General Entertainment Authority chairman finished a purchase deal for the Spanish club UD Almeria.

The Spanish side posted a photo on their official Twitter page saying that Al-Sheikh has become their new owner without giving any further information.

The Ex-honorary President of Al-Ahly club sold Pyramids FC to Emirati investor Salem Al-Shamsi on Friday, June 5.

The Saudi General Entertainment Authority chairman bought the Egyptian side Assiouty Sport in June 2018, renaming it to Pyramids FC.

Pyramids finished third in the Egyptian Premier League with 70 points after delivering an impressive season under the ownership of Al- Sheikh. The club managed to beat the league’s winner Al-Ahly and the runner-up Zamalek during the last season.
